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3049 36216332413 77 802730335
6398212 5273975987
6398212 5273975987
757 94 158836940 09
All about undefined
Interested in learning more?
6398212 5273975987
757 94 158836940 09
See more
44 66724525043
595459265 07707599535 3764496477 5094269720
See more
00093646435 40420062025
954936 12 3864503297
See more